Robotics Surgical Simulation Systems Market Forecast Global Robotics Surgical Simulation Systems Market Forecast, 2019-2024 The global robotic surgical simulation systems market was valued to be $276.5 million in the year 2018 and is anticipated to witness an impressive double-digit growth rate, to reach $1.03 Billion by 2024. Market Segmentation The robotics surgical simulation systems market has been segmented on the basis of product type, application, end user, and region. The product type segment is further segmented into conventional surgery and minimally invasive surgery simulation platforms and robotic surgery simulation platforms. On the basis of application, it is further segmented into general surgery, gynecology surgery, urology surgery, orthopaedic surgery, neurological surgery, cardiological surgery, other surgical applications. Based on the end user segment, the market is segmented into hospitals, academic institutes and teaching hospitals, and commercial simulation center. Lastly, the regional segment is further segmented into North America, Europe, Asia-Pacific, and Rest-of-the-World (ROW). Key Companies in the Robotics Surgical Simulation Industry The key players contributing to the global robotics surgical simulation systems market are 3D Systems Corporation, CAE Inc., Intuitive Surgical Inc., Mentice AB, Mimic Technologies, Inc., Simulated Surgical Systems, LLC, Touch of Life Technologies (ToLTech), VirtaMed AG, Voxel-Man, and VRmagic.
